Drinking Water Filtration in Bergen County, NJ
Drinking water filtration services focus on improving the quality and safety of tap water for residential properties. These services typically involve installing, maintaining, or upgrading filtration systems that remove contaminants such as chlorine, sediment, lead, bacteria, and other impurities. Projects can range from adding point-of-use filters under kitchen sinks to whole-house filtration systems that treat water at the main supply line, ensuring clean and safe drinking water throughout the home.
Homeowners often seek drinking water filtration services to address concerns about water taste, odor, or potential health risks from contaminants. Before requesting service, property owners usually want to understand the types of filtration options available, the specific issues present in their water supply, and the maintenance requirements of different systems. Clarifying these details helps determine the most suitable solution for their household needs and ensures access to reliable, high-quality drinking water.

Common Drinking Water Filtration Jobs
Point-of-Use Filtration - installs under-sink systems to improve drinking water quality directly at the tap.
Whole-House Filtration - provides comprehensive water treatment for the entire property.
Reverse Osmosis Systems - removes contaminants for cleaner, safer drinking water through advanced filtration.
Sediment and Dirt Removal - addresses particulate matter to prevent clogging and improve water clarity.
Water Softening Solutions - reduces mineral buildup to prevent scale and extend appliance life.
UV Water Purification - uses ultraviolet light to eliminate bacteria and viruses from the water supply.
Drinking Water Filtration Questions
What types of drinking water filtration systems are available? There are various options including activated carbon filters, reverse osmosis units, and UV purifiers, each designed to address different contaminants and improve water quality.
How do I know if my water needs filtration? Signs include unusual tastes or odors, visible particles, or if testing indicates the presence of contaminants such as chlorine, lead, or bacteria.
What are the benefits of installing a water filtration system? Filtration can improve water taste and odor, reduce harmful substances, and provide safer drinking water for households and properties.
Are maintenance requirements for water filters complicated? Maintenance typically involves regular filter replacements and system checks to ensure optimal performance and water quality.
